The Internal Revenue Department (IRD) has announced that tax verification and payment of applicable taxes for motor vehicle ownership transfers can now be completed online using a Digital Payment system.

According to the announcement, beginning 16 July 2026, the IRD has introduced the Vehicle Automatic Valuation System (VAVS) to handle tax assessments for the transfer of ownership of motor vehicles that are already registered with the Road Transport Administration Department. The new system applies to transfers between individual owners.

Under the new procedure, taxpayers can access the VAVS portal at https://vavs.ird.gov.mm by registering with their mobile phone number. After logging into the system and entering the vehicle registration number along with the required information, the system will automatically assess the vehicle's value, calculate the applicable tax, and allow users to pay the required amount through the online Digital Payment system.

Tax payment can be made through MPU Debit Card through IRD's Tax Payment Hub connected to VAVS system, or by using MMQR Code through KBZ Payı AYA Payı CB Payı uab Payı A plus Walletı Citizen Payı OKŞı Wave Moneyı Trusty Payı Zego Payı M-Pitesanı GTB Payı MoMoney, etc., and through Mobile Banking systems of uab Bankı Shwe Bankı A Bank.

After paying the tax, the e-Tax Clearance Certificate QR Form obtained from VAVS system will be clearly printed and the vehicle name change process will be carried out at the Department of Land Transport Administration.

Initial registration of vehicles, name change registration under company name, and income reporting issues will continue to be processed at the relevant offices as per the original procedures.
